NINA

by Juraj Lehotský

synopsis

Nina is twelve years old and her world has just been shattered to smithereens: Her parents’ marriage has broken down and they are getting a divorce. After his internationally successful debut Miracle Juraj Lehotský now brings us an intimate drama in which the viewer looks upon the world and the selfish, visionless behaviour of adults through the eyes of a 12-year-old girl. A girl who is resilient and belligerent, but also vulnerable and just as fragile as the miniature world she creates for herself in the garden shed.

original title: Nina
country: Slovakia, Czech Republic
sales agent: Alpha Violet
year: 2017
genre: fiction
directed by: Juraj Lehotský
film run: 86'
screenplay: Juraj Lehotský, Marek Lešcák
cast: Bibiana Nováková, Robert Roth, Petra Fornayová, Josef Kleindienst
cinematography by: Norbert Hudec
film editing: Radoslav Dubravský
art director: Juraj Fábry
music: Aleš Březina
producer: Ivan Ostrochovský, Katarína Tomková
production: Punkchart Films, Endorfilm, Lehotský Film, Sentimentalfilm
backing: Česká televize, Rozhlas a televízia Slovenska
